Transaction 7e64c89ab76143ee0d0b37dcf9dd81ae811f408c5dd0fd5bac48e78878251620
1 Input
1 Output
-
7e64c89ab76143ee0d0b37dcf9dd81ae811f408c5dd0fd5bac48e78878251620:0
- value
- 557976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fd719b12aab03dbf51c97f84b0e5ab9112b900b OP_EQUAL
- address
- 3DLyRLk6RsiuHgR65LGTiJwoN4dTrF9Pq7